Maguire Gets 6.5, Onana With 5.5 | Manchester United Players Rated In Dismal Loss Vs Newcastle United

Manchester United welcomed Newcastle United at Old Trafford earlier tonight as they looked to secure a positive result at home in the EFL Cup. The Red Devils were lackluster in the first half and conceded the opening goal in the 28th minute when Miguel Almiron got his name on the scoresheet. Lewis Hall doubled Newcastle’s lead just eight minutes later as Man United went into the half-time break 2-0 down on the scoreline.

Joe Willock put the match to bed at the hour mark as Erik ten Hag’s men crashed to a dismal 3-0 loss at the Theatre of Dreams.

Let’s take a look at how each Manchester United player fared during the clash against the Magpies.

GK: Andre Onana – 5.5/10

Onana made two solid saves at the back but conceded three times tonight.

RB: Diogo Dalot – 6/10

He made some solid tackles but was lackluster in the first half. Dalot was replaced at half-time.

CB: Harry Maguire – 6.5/10

Maguire made some important clearances inside his half but won’t be pleased about conceding three goals during his time on the field.

CB: Victor Lindelof – 6.5/10

He didn’t hesitate to clear the danger when needed and was a good presence on the ball.

LB: Sergio Reguilon – 6/10

The Spaniard earned the ball back a few times but struggled to influence the game in the final third.

CM: Casemiro – 6/10

He earned the ball back but failed to create anything meaningful in the Newcastle half.

CM: Mason Mount – 6/10

Mount struggled to impress and put in an underwhelming display at the centre of the park.

RW: Antony – 6/10

He had a couple of lively moments in the opponent’s half but never looked like scoring.

CAM: Hannibal Mejbri – 6/10

Mejbri struggled to cause problems for the Newcastle defenders and was substituted after the hour mark.

LW: Alejandro Garnacho – 6/10

He made two inviting chances in the final third and has got nothing to show for his efforts.

ST: Anthony Martial – 6/10

The French striker was quiet for most of his time on the pitch.

Substitutes:

CM: Sofyan Amrabat – 6/10

He made two good opportunities for his teammates.

RB: Aaron Wan-Bissaka – 6.5/10

Wan-Bissaka caught the eye at times in the opponent’s half.

ST: Rasmus Hojlund – 6/10

His impact on the game was minimal.

LW: Marcus Rashford – 6/10

Rashford failed to trouble the opponent’s goal.

CAM: Bruno Fernandes – 6.5/10

He had a couple of bright moments in the game.
